Serena Williams Pays Tribute to Virgil Abloh with Surprise Runway Appearance

In a heartfelt homage to the late fashion designer Virgil Abloh, tennis superstar Serena Williams made a stunning surprise runway appearance at the Louis Vuitton Spring/Summer 2023 show held during Paris Fashion Week. Abloh, renowned for his innovative contributions to the fashion world and as the artistic director of Louis Vuitton’s menswear, passed away in November 2021 due to a rare form of cancer. His influence extended beyond fashion, marking significant strides in the realms of art, music, and culture.

Williams, who recently announced her retirement from professional tennis, was an unexpected yet impactful addition to the runway. Her presence not only honored Abloh’s legacy but also demonstrated the deep connections he forged with numerous athletes, particularly in how he intertwined sports with high fashion.
